Can I shave above my lip?

Published in Hair Removal 2 mins read

Yes, you can shave above your lip. Shaving is a common and easy way to remove upper lip hair. It involves using a razor and shaving cream to remove hair above the skin surface. While the results are not long-lasting, it is a quick solution, making it suitable for emergencies.

Here are some tips for shaving your upper lip:

  • Prepare your skin: Wet your skin with lukewarm water and apply shaving gel or cream to soften the hair and lubricate the skin.
  • Use a sharp razor: A sharp razor will give you a closer shave and reduce the risk of ingrown hairs.
  • Shave in the direction of hair growth: Shaving against the grain can cause irritation and ingrown hairs.
  • Avoid excessive pressure: Gentle pressure is sufficient for a clean shave.
  • Moisturize after shaving: Apply a gentle moisturizer to soothe and hydrate your skin.

Note: Shaving can lead to stubble, which may be more noticeable than the original hair. If you have dark or thick hair, consider alternative methods like waxing or laser hair removal.
